Discord Bot Integration: A Guide to Unleashing the Power of Chat
Introduction
Hello, friends! Today, I'll provide you with a comprehensive guide on Discord Bot Integration. This guide will offer a detailed walkthrough on how to integrate bots that enhance the functionality of the Discord platform.
Target Audience and Purpose
This guide is designed for Discord server administrators, bot developers, and general users. The aim is to explain the basics of Discord bot integration and teach step-by-step how to achieve it.
What is Discord Bot Integration?
Discord Bot Integration is a way to make your Discord servers more functional and enjoyable. Through these integrations, you can expand your server's features, add custom commands, and increase interaction.
Basic Information
Discord bots are software programmed to perform various tasks in Discord servers. They can handle tasks such as moderation, music playback, games, and custom commands. Bot integration involves adding a bot to your Discord server and using it.
Importance of Bot Integration
Bot integration makes your Discord servers more interactive and customizable. It automates moderation tasks, enhances user experience, and allows you to personalize your server with custom bot commands.
Choosing a Bot
Choosing from the array of Discord bots is crucial to finding one that suits your needs. Here are some popular Discord bots and feature comparisons:
Popular Discord Bots
1. Dyno
- Known for moderation features.
- User-friendly for adding custom commands.
2. MEE6
- Offers a leveling system and moderation features.
- Customizable bot commands.
3. Rythm
- Recognized for high-quality music playback.
- Improves the music experience in your server.
Integration Steps
Understanding the steps of bot integration is the first step to successfully adding your bot. Here are the basic integration steps:
Bot Creation and Token Acquisition
- Go to the Discord Developer Portal.
- Create a new application and navigate to the "Bot" tab.
- Create a bot by clicking "Add Bot."
- Go to the "OAuth2" tab to add your bot to the server.
- Specify permissions and add the bot to your server using the generated link.
Adding to the Server
- Add your bot to your server using the OAuth2 link.
- Once successfully added, the bot will have access to your server's channels.
By following these steps, you can seamlessly integrate your bot into your server.
Bot Commands and Features
Understanding the basic commands and advanced features of your bot allows for effective usage.
Basic Commands
- !help: Lists the bot's basic commands.
- !clear [number]: Clears the specified number of messages.
- !level: Displays the user's level.
Advanced Features
Music Playback
- Enjoy high-quality music with bots like Rythm.
Moderation
- Manage your server with bots like Dyno.
Explore the specified commands to enhance interaction in your server.
Security and Permission Settings
Ensuring the security and permission settings of your bot is crucial for protecting your server.
Bot Security
To secure your bot:
- Do not share your token with anyone.
- Use a trusted and updated bot.
User Permissions
Carefully control the permissions given to your bot. Blocking unnecessary permissions enhances your server's security.
Customizing Your Bot
Customizing your bot's appearance and behavior makes the server experience more enjoyable.
Profile and Appearance Settings
- Set your bot's profile picture.
- Personalize your bot's username.
Adding Custom Commands
Enhance interaction in your server by adding custom commands, such as:
- !hello: Greet users with a welcome command.
- !weather [city]: Provide weather information using a bot command.
Conclusion
Discord Bot Integration is an excellent way to transform your servers from mere chat platforms to interactive environments. Properly integrating and customizing your bot can significantly enhance the user experience.
FAQs
Why is my bot not working?
There could be several reasons why your bot is not working. Ensure that your token is correct and that your bot is configured accurately.
What precautions can I take for my bot's security?
To keep your bot secure, never share your token and use trusted permissions. Regularly check for security updates.
How can I add custom commands to my bot?
Adding custom commands to your bot is straightforward. Refer to your bot's documentation to get started.
How can I join the Discord Bot community?
To join the Discord bot community, visit various forums and Discord servers. It's a great way to share questions and meet new people.
What's the best way to keep my bot updated?
To keep your bot updated, follow official sources and community forums. Regularly check and apply software updates.